Hello !
1.I have no idea.
2. While doing nothing 40 degree both CPU/GPU, full load 90 CPU/92 GPU
3. Battery life variates, between 2 to 4 hours in my case.
4. Noise level, well while doing light things is kinda noiseless, however while playing light games it do tend to sound abit high, worst is when you play heavy games.
5. The keyboard is something you need to "learn" to love... I can speak for myself and I hate it but yet I am trying to love it as much I can...
About BF3, do not expect super performance @ this moment however sooner or later we will be able to play medium @1600x900 with decent frame rates this is what nvidia forums promises with their future drivers...
